Many open source projects have moved to using SPDX identifiers
to specify license information, reducing the amount of
boilerplate code in every source file.  This patch replaces
the bulk of SPDK .c, .cpp and Makefiles with the BSD-3-Clause
identifier.

Almost all of these files share the exact same license text,
and this patch only modifies the files that contain the
most common license text.  There can be slight variations
because the third clause contains company names - most say
"Intel Corporation", but there are instances for Nvidia,
Samsung, Eideticom and even "the copyright holder".

Used a bash script to automate replacement of the license text
with SPDX identifier which is checked into scripts/spdx.sh.

/* SPDX-License-Identifier: BSD-3-Clause
* Copyright (c) Intel Corporation. All rights reserved.
* Copyright (c) 2018 Mellanox Technologies LTD. All rights reserved.
*/
#include "spdk/stdinc.h"
#include "spdk/rpc.h"
#include "spdk/util.h"
#include "vhost_fuzz.h"
struct rpc_fuzz_vhost_dev_create {
char *socket;
bool is_blk;
bool use_bogus_buffer;
bool use_valid_buffer;
bool valid_lun;
bool test_scsi_tmf;
};
static const struct spdk_json_object_decoder rpc_fuzz_vhost_dev_create_decoders[] = {
{"socket", offsetof(struct rpc_fuzz_vhost_dev_create, socket), spdk_json_decode_string},
{"is_blk", offsetof(struct rpc_fuzz_vhost_dev_create, is_blk), spdk_json_decode_bool, true},
{"use_bogus_buffer", offsetof(struct rpc_fuzz_vhost_dev_create, use_bogus_buffer), spdk_json_decode_bool, true},
{"use_valid_buffer", offsetof(struct rpc_fuzz_vhost_dev_create, use_valid_buffer), spdk_json_decode_bool, true},
{"valid_lun", offsetof(struct rpc_fuzz_vhost_dev_create, valid_lun), spdk_json_decode_bool, true},
{"test_scsi_tmf", offsetof(struct rpc_fuzz_vhost_dev_create, test_scsi_tmf), spdk_json_decode_bool, true},
};
static void
spdk_rpc_fuzz_vhost_create_dev(struct spdk_jsonrpc_request *request,
const struct spdk_json_val *params)
{
struct rpc_fuzz_vhost_dev_create req = {0};
int rc;
if (spdk_json_decode_object(params, rpc_fuzz_vhost_dev_create_decoders,
SPDK_COUNTOF(rpc_fuzz_vhost_dev_create_decoders), &req)) {
fprintf(stderr, "Unable to parse the request.\n");
spdk_jsonrpc_send_error_response(request, SPDK_JSONRPC_ERROR_INVALID_PARAMS,
"Unable to parse the object parameters.\n");
return;
}
if (strlen(req.socket) > PATH_MAX) {
fprintf(stderr, "Socket address is too long.\n");
spdk_jsonrpc_send_error_response(request, SPDK_JSONRPC_ERROR_INVALID_PARAMS,
"Unable to parse the object parameters.\n");
free(req.socket);
return;
}
rc = fuzz_vhost_dev_init(req.socket, req.is_blk, req.use_bogus_buffer, req.use_valid_buffer,
req.valid_lun, req.test_scsi_tmf);
if (rc != 0) {
if (rc == -ENOMEM) {
fprintf(stderr, "No valid memory for device initialization.\n");
spdk_jsonrpc_send_error_response(request, SPDK_JSONRPC_ERROR_INTERNAL_ERROR,
"No memory returned from host.\n");
} else if (rc == -EINVAL) {
fprintf(stderr, "Invalid device parameters provided.\n");
spdk_jsonrpc_send_error_response(request, SPDK_JSONRPC_ERROR_INVALID_PARAMS,
"Parameters provided were invalid.\n");
} else {
fprintf(stderr, "unknown error from the guest.\n");
spdk_jsonrpc_send_error_response(request, SPDK_JSONRPC_ERROR_INTERNAL_ERROR,
"Unexpected error code.\n");
}
} else {
spdk_jsonrpc_send_bool_response(request, true);
}
free(req.socket);
return;
}
SPDK_RPC_REGISTER("fuzz_vhost_create_dev", spdk_rpc_fuzz_vhost_create_dev, SPDK_RPC_STARTUP);
